Output 423793225212ec689185816f298ec5729f1141f0facf7fa33a4754d474265409:1

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 291c60ccc87c6164ee3bc5a55e908c73a0ed14ef OP_EQUALVERIFY OP_CHECKSIG
address
14kNhcUqBYtMdYnR8m9sUKteP64YAsbEeh
transaction
423793225212ec689185816f298ec5729f1141f0facf7fa33a4754d474265409
spent
true